Jr NTR approaches Delhi High Court. The Tollywood star Junior NTR has filed a case against the various platforms of social media and e-commerce sites for misusing his personality rights before the High Court at Delhi. It was alleged in the petition that so many accounts and pages have put contents and pictures before the public under his name and likeness without any authorization.
According to Junior NTR, this very exploitation confounds the fans but also destroys the brand value and personal identity of the star.
The petition is being filed through Senior Counsel Sai Deepak, renowned for his high-profile cases involving digital rights and online platforms. Counsel for Junior NTR argued that the unauthorized content circulating on these platforms infringes upon Junior NTR’s right of publicity and personality rights available in law in India.
The matter was taken before the Bench of Justice Manmeet Pritam Singh Arora.
The bench of Justice Manmeet Pritam Singh Arora dealing with the matter recognized the need for some sort of framework to protect the identity of the celebrity in a digitalized world. The Court took cognizance of the growing possibility of misuse of names of celebrities for purposes other than business, misinformation, and fake endorsements through social media.
In a landmark judgment, the Delhi High Court directed major social media platforms to take immedialy all actions necessary with respect to those accounts and pages infringing Junior NTR’s personality rights. The Court also ordered all such social media to review and take down any content that unlawfully exploited the name, image, or any other likeness of the actor.
After that, the action shall be taken in the manner provided under the IT Rules 2021.
This would be in accordance with the IT Rules 2021, as termed by the Court, for redress and content moderation without further delay. To add, no e-commerce sites must sell any kind of products or promotional material using the name and identity of Junior NTR without prior approval.

This is perceived as a strong step towards strengthening the rights of celebrities in the online domain. Therefore, Junior NTR’s petition indeed seeks to protect Junior NTR’s identity and also sets a very important precedent for safeguarding digital personality rights in India.
